curious if anyone mods iPad cases around here.
I recently got a "hand-me-down" an iPad2 and I remember seeing the Otterbox Defender for iPad1 @ Target for $24 Clearance price (Retails around . So most of outside features for iPad2 is not readily accessible for the OTDef iPad1 case understandably, but with a little drilling and filing this could be resolved. Plus according to most reviews on Amazon of the OTDef iPad2 case, doesn't have the same ruggedness and heavy plastic coverage as of the iPad1 case.
It fits snuggly inside the iPad1 case. And it does gives you the feel that this case can take the beating.
Just curious if anyone else have modded their iPad cases around here.
earphone jack is not lined up
need to create more holes for the speaker
rubber handles for grip
some accent around the logo
going to drill a bigger hole, so far the bottom edge is blocking
volume toggle cannot be reached because of the bevel, so making the hole bigger wider, a finger should fit --- gonna be trial and error here

The drives were purchased knowing they would be used on a SATA II controller, so I didn't swing for SATA III drives. I would have went with another drive if I had SATA III on both slots. These happened to be the lowest cost option, and reportedly reliable with its 32nm NAND flash that is rated for more writes than 25nm counterparts.
I don't really care about synthetic benchmark numbers, and the newer SATA III SSD's aren't much faster at writing uncompressed video. The 'peak' numbers sure are higher, but they don't perform much better at writing uncompressed video.
Reliability, performance, and cost were all concerns. The Sandisk Ultra II's happened to most adequately fit my needs.

The Sandisk Ultra II is rated at 30,000 IOPS 4KB random read, which is 50% higher than the Agility 3. The read/write speeds are similar, at 195 MB/s read 130 MB/s write, in AS-SSD. This would indicate a maximum throughput of 390MB/s and 260MB/s respectively on the Agility 3, of which my real life setup achieves around 85% of, on a SATA II controller.
http://www.newegg.com/Product/Produc...82E16820227726
The 120GB version is $30 more than I paid for my drives for identical capacity.
I did a bit of research, and these drives appear to be the best bang for the buck, along with being one of the higher performing SATA II SSD's on the market.
